繁体   English   中英

java ftp删除所有文件而不删除文件夹

[英]java ftp delete all files without deleting folders

如何使用Java删除ftp服务器上的所有文件而不删除文件夹。

例如,我在文件夹中有以下文件:

/TEST/DOCUMENT/1/111.txt

/TEST/DOCUMENT/1/222.txt

/TEST/DOCUMENT/2/333.txt

/TEST/DOCUMENT/2/444.txt

/TEST/PDF/1/111.pdf

/TEST/PDF/1/222.pdf

/TEST/PDF/2/333.pdf

我只需要删除文件,不能删除文件夹

您是否有权访问系统,还是要“通过” ftp进行访问? 如果有访问权限,此软件会提供“仅删除文件”选项,因此,如果删除文件夹,它将删除其下的所有文件,并将文件夹保留为空。 http://www.softpedia.com/get/File-managers/JFileProcessor.shtml https://github.com/stant/jfileprocessor

还将允许您使用名称,大小,日期,X或所有深度的子文件夹搜索具有glob或regex的文件。 您可以保存到“列表”窗口或文件。 然后,您可以运行一个groovy(思考Java)脚本来对文件列表执行任何操作。 压缩或压缩它们,修改列表字符串,如sed,删除,移动,复制文件,grep或ls -l它们,等等。 它还可以让您按摩列表,例如添加到列表,从列表中删除,从另一个列表中减去一个列表。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M